English: Loligosepia aalensis (jr synonym Geoteuthis bollensis), Loligosepiidae, with preserved inc sac in which the pigment eumelanin is still present; Lower Jurassic, Toarcium, Holzmaden, Germany; Staatliches Museum für Naturkunde Karlsruhe, Germany.
